Abstract
1,067,591. Fuel tank pressurization systems. INTERTECHNIQUE. Feb. 10, 1965, No. 5773/65. Heading B7W. [Also in Division G1] An aircraft fuel tank pressurization system has a pressure indicator, indicating the pressure in the pressurization pipe leading to the tank, and an indicator indicating the direction of flow in the pipe. The flow direction indicator may comprise a rotary screw, or as described in the Specification, consists of a flap in a Venturi pivotable by the flow to touch either of two electrical contacts and cause either of two lamps to be lit indicating the direction of flow. These lamps may be mounted on the dial of a pressure gauge forming the pressure indicator. The apparatus is located between the tank and a control system which connects the pipe selectively to a ram air inlet or to an air outlet to maintain a constant gauge pressure in the tank. Thus if the pressure is too high, the lamps should indicate that air is leaving the tank, and vice versa if the pressure is low. If the right combination of signals does not occur, the control system should be isolated from the tank, and the apparatus may be arranged to actuate a valve to effect this, and to operate an alarm.
